About Never Gonna Give You Up

"Never Gonna Give You Up" is a song recorded by British singer and songwriter Rick Astley, released as a single on 27 July 1987. It was written and produced by Stock Aitken Waterman. The song was released as the first single from Astley's debut album, Whenever You Need Somebody (1987). The song was a worldwide number-one hit, initially in the singer's native United Kingdom in 1987, where it stayed at the top of the chart for five weeks and was the best-selling single of that year. It eventually topped the charts in 25 countries, including the United States and West Germany. The song won Best British Single at the 1988 Brit Awards. In 1990, Nick Lowe quoted from the song and called it "ghastly" in the lyrics to "All Men Are Liars", a song on his album Party of One. In 2004, "Never Gonna Give You Up" was voted number 28 in 50 Most Awesomely Bad Songs... Ever by VH1. The music video for the song has become the basis for the "Rickrolling" Internet meme, leading the song to also be referred to as "The Rickroll Song". In 2008, Astley won the MTV Europe Music Award for Best Act Ever with the song, as a result of collective voting from thousands of people on the Internet, due to the popular phenomenon of Rickrolling. The song is considered Astley's signature song and it is often played at the end of his live concerts.

Rick Astley

Richard Paul "Rick" Astley ( /ˈrɪk ˈæstli/; born 6 February 1966) is an English singer-songwriter, musician, and radio personality. He is known for his 1987 song, "Never Gonna Give You Up", which was a #1 hit single in 25 countries. Astley holds the record for being the only male solo artist to have his first 8 singles reach the Top 10 in the UK and by retirement in 1993 had sold approximately 40 million records worldwide. https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=2JLWvkkU0Z4 more »

12 facts about this song

Release Information
"Never Gonna Give You Up" by Rick Astley was first released as a single on July 27, 1987.
Studio Produced
The catchy pop tune was produced by the renowned trio Stock Aitken Waterman at their PWL studios in South London.
Rick Astley's Debut
This song is actually Rick Astley's debut single, and it helped him achieve instantaneous global success.
Chart Performance
The song was a massive success internationally, reaching the No.1 spot in 25 countries including the UK, US, and Germany.
Praised & Awarded
Besides its commercial success, the song was recognized as the "Best British Single" in 1988 by the Brit Awards.
Music Video
The song's music video has become infamous on the internet for a practice called "Rickrolling," where an individual is tricked into watching the video through hyperlinks that purportedly lead to other content.
Rickrolling Phenomenon
The phrase ‘Rickrolling’ was entered into the Oxford English Dictionary in 2010, which shows how big the phenomenon had become.
Re-emergence of Popularity
Rick Astley's career experienced a revival with the rise of Rickrolling in the late 2000s, more than two decades after the song's initial release.
Streaming Milestone
In July 2021, the "Never Gonna Give You Up" music video reached an astounding milestone – it surpassed 1 billion views on YouTube.
Song Lyrics
The song lyrics, central to the theme of Rickrolling, are iconic. The phrases "Never gonna give you up... Never gonna let you down..." are globally recognized.
Instrumental Arrangement
The song features a characteristic blend of synthesized basslines, a soulful melody, punchy beats, and keyboards, typical of the high-energy dance pop of the 80s.
Rick Astley's Perception
Many years later, Rick Astley has admitted to having mixed feelings about the song due to its association with Rickrolling, but appreciates how much joy the song has brought to people.
